&lt;p&gt;thanks&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div style="clear:both;"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</description></item><item><title>RE: how to use nrf5340 dk to debug nrf52840dongle?</title><link>https://devzone.nordicsemi.com/thread/376231?ContentTypeID=1</link><pubDate>Fri, 08 Jul 2022 13:24:23 GMT</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">137ad170-7792-4731-bb38-c0d22fbe4515:e8e1287a-1405-4efe-b29e-587fe15cc3d9</guid><dc:creator>Jared</dc:creator><description>&lt;p&gt;The nRF5340 DK documentation states:&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;em&gt;&lt;strong&gt;The voltage supported by external debugging/programming is VDD voltage. Normally, this is 3 V when running from USB. But if the onboard&amp;nbsp;&lt;span&gt;nRF5340&lt;/span&gt;&amp;nbsp;SoC is supplied from either USB or lithium-ion (Li-ion) and the nRF power source switch (&lt;span&gt;SW9&lt;/span&gt;) is in either&amp;nbsp;&lt;span&gt;Li-Po&lt;/span&gt;&amp;nbsp;or&amp;nbsp;&lt;span&gt;USB&lt;/span&gt;&amp;nbsp;position, then the VDD can be set by the&amp;nbsp;&lt;span&gt;nRF5340&lt;/span&gt;&amp;nbsp;firmware. Make sure the voltage level of the external board matches the VDD of the&amp;nbsp;&lt;span&gt;nRF5340 DK&lt;/span&gt;.&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Can you verify that the VDD on the nRF5340 and the Dongle is the same?&amp;nbsp;&lt;/p&gt;
